To step 110 V ac down to 20 V ac, the turns ratio must be
A:
5.5
B:
18
C:
0.18
D:
0.018
Answer: C

Vp/Vs = Np/Ns

Vs = (Ns/Np)Vp

We required turns ratio i.e., (Ns/Np)

= Vs/Vp

= 20/110

= 0.181818182

[Note: p - primary; s - secondary]

For step down transfer, the turns ratio will be less than 1.

The primary winding of a transformer has 110 V ac across it. What is the secondary voltage if the turns ratio is 8?
A:
8.8 V
B:
88 V
C:
880 V
D:
8,800 V
Answer: C

V2/V1 = N2/N1

Turns ratio = N2/N1 = 8.

V2/110 = 8

V2 = 8 x 110

V2 = 880v.
